Restaurant Introduction

Nestled on Duddell Street in Central, A Lux is an exquisite fine-dining Contemporary Japanese European restaurant. The cuisine features the freshest seasonal Japanese ingredients, fused with modern European cooking techniques and infused with the spirit of “shun” (seasonality), presenting dishes that embody both Japanese delicacy and European elegance in perfect harmony.

Every supplier is personally selected by Group Executive Chef Leung, ensuring the same premium seafood quality as the group’s flagship sushi restaurant, Sushi Rin. Each dish is a true East–West creation, preserving the purity and refinement of Japanese cuisine while showcasing the modern sophistication of European gastronomy.

The name A Lux also carries symbolic meaning. Duddell Street is famous for its historic gas lamps, representing warmth and light. “A Lux” derives from the Latin word for “a light,” paying tribute to this heritage while aspiring to become a beacon that guides diners on a journey of Japanese–European fusion cuisine.

Inspired by the glow of gaslight, the restaurant’s interior blends vintage elegance with modern minimalism, creating a romantic atmosphere that transcends time. Guests are transported between history and the present, experiencing a unique interplay of cultural depth and contemporary aesthetics.

Chef Introduction


Over the years, A Lux has specialized in traditional-flavored modern European cuisine—signature dishes such as pressed French duck, lobster bisque, French-style roasted suckling pig, and house-made pasta have long defined our kitchen. Since 2025, we have embraced the spirit of shun (seasonality), introducing the philosophy and craftsmanship of Japanese cuisine to our table. Group Executive Chef Leung personally selects the seafood and seasonal ingredients from Japan, overseeing and guiding key techniques such as dashi preparation, sashimi handling, and charcoal grilling. Meanwhile, Chef Peter, with over a decade of European culinary experience, refines each creation with delicate plating artistry—blending the clarity and purity of Japanese flavors with the fire-driven aesthetics of European cuisine. This forms the distinctive A Lux identity: “Japanese Essence × European Technique.”

Classic European dishes will return seasonally as special highlights, while our handcrafted pasta remains a signature specialty we take pride in. Chef Peter, a graduate of the VTC Culinary Academy, has trained at Harlan’s, Rustico (under Juanjo Carrillo), The Principal, and Pano (under Ken Lau). His expertise lies in striking a subtle balance between “authentic flavor” and “culinary aesthetics.”

Our vision is to bring Hong Kong gourmets a contemporary dining experience that feels both familiar and refreshingly new—through purer flavors and more precise techniques.
